INDONESIA POWER UNIT PEMBANGKITAN SURALAYA}, year={2018}, url={http://156.67.221.169/771/}, abstract={Power plant is a unit system used to produce electrical energy which is then delivered to the transmission network and distributed to consumers. Steam power plant at PT. Indonesia Power UP Suralaya which has a total capacity of 3400 MW with 7 unit of the plant which supply electricity to Java and Bali, that should be able to work with the maximum and reliable for distributed electricity supply to consumers. Power plant main equipment is generator transformer, which used to transform the low voltage into high voltage. As the main safety and to ensure the reliability, added relay protection on the generator transformer. Protective relay is a device used to detect fault, either internal or external. The relay used in generator and transformer unit 5 is differential relay. Differential relay is a safety relay used to detect the internal fault in the power transformer that it works very fast and selective. Pickup current in this differential relay is 1,5 A, from testing performance pick up current set in 1,48 A. CT that they are using are class 5P20 with composite error 1,3%. From the calculation the result for 3 phase short circuit 7,7375 A which mean when there are fault current bigger than the current setting the relay will be pickup, also the relay doesn?t pickup in interfal fault happen.} }
